A library to convert between AQI value and pollutant concentration (µg/m³ or ppm)

Project description

A library to convert between AQI value and pollutant concentration (µg/m³ or ppm) using the following algorithms:

  • United States Environmental Protection Agency (EPA)

  • China Ministry of Environmental Protection (MEP)

  • Central Pollution Control Board (CPCB) India

Forked from python-aqi library

Changes from the original library

  • Added CPCB AQI Calculation

  • Added IEMA Brazil AQI Calculation

  • Added Kuwait AQI

  • Added Unit Conversion Functions

  • Added Exception Handling (returns the number or NaN back if it can’t convert)

Install

$ pip install aqicalc

Usage

Library

NOTE: Different standards use different units for calculating AQI, use the appropriate units to get correct results. Examples for getting the units for each standards as well as unit conversion is avaiable (examples soon!)

Convert a pollutant to its IAQI (Intermediate Air Quality Index):

import aqicalc as aqi
myaqi = aqi.to_iaqi(aqi.POLLUTANT_PM25, '12', algo=aqi.ALGO_EPA)

Get an AQI out of several pollutant concentrations, default algorithm is EPA:

import aqicalc as aqi
myaqi = aqi.to_aqi([
    (aqi.POLLUTANT_PM25, '12'),
    (aqi.POLLUTANT_PM10, '24'),
    (aqi.POLLUTANT_O3_8H, '0.087')
])

Convert an IAQI to its pollutant concentration:

import aqicalc as aqi
mycc = aqi.to_cc(aqi.POLLUTANT_PM25, '22', algo=aqi.ALGO_EPA)

Command line

List supported algorithms and pollutants:

$ aqi -l
aqi.algos.epa: pm10 (µg/m³), o3_8h (ppm), co_8h (ppm), no2_1h (ppb), o3_1h (ppm), so2_1h (ppb), pm25 (µg/m³)
aqi.algos.mep: no2_24h (µg/m³), so2_24h (µg/m³), no2_1h (µg/m³), pm10 (µg/m³), o3_1h (µg/m³), o3_8h (µg/m³), so2_1h (µg/m³), co_1h (mg/m³), pm25 (µg/m³), co_24h (mg/m³)

Convert PM2.5 to IAQI using EPA algorithm:

$ aqi aqi.algos.epa pm25:12
50

Convert PM2.5 to IAQI using EPA algorithm (full length):

$ aqi -c aqi aqi.algos.epa pm25:12
50

Convert pollutants concentrations to AQI using EPA algorithm:

$ aqi aqi.algos.epa pm25:40.9 o3_8h:0.077 co_1h:8.4
114

Convert pollutants concentrations to AQI using EPA algorithm, display IAQIs:

$ aqi -v aqi.algos.epa pm25:40.9 o3_8h:0.077 co_1h:8.4
pm25:102 o3_8h:104 co_1h:90
114

Convert PM2.5 IAQI to concentration using EPA algorithm:

$ aqi -c cc aqi.algos.epa pm25:39
pm2.5:9.3
